Freeallmusic Nabs Universal for Ad Funded MP3's

FreeAllMusic.com has signed a deal with Universal Music Group to offer free ad supported digital music downloads. FAM will offer DRM free mp3 downloads in exchange for watching a brief video commercial. There is no software required and after the download the users' music selections and sponsoring brands are only promoted externally through an opt-in ad network.During the sites current private beta, users will be offered up to 20 free downloads per month.

In October, CEO Richard Nailling told Hypebot, “We have one major label signed and intend to have all four majors signed by our launch date". Thus far, Universal is the only major label to officially sign with the service.
